How to create the Spellbinders May Monthly Clubs Stitched Card.
Start with a 4-1/4″ x 5-1/2″ piece of Seaside cardstock. Ink blend the Simon Says Stamp Seafoam Ink through the retro background stencil from the May Write On club. Attach it to a top-folding A2-sized white card base. 4-1/4″ x 11″, score and fold at 5-1/2″.
Next, die-cut all the elements from Spellbinders Cardstock:
- Chair – Teal Topaz
- Plant – Peridot and Rainforest
- Pot – Lilac
- Rug – Mulberry
- Lamp – Saffron
- Chair base and lamp trim – black
Stitch the chair with DMC #3812, stitch the lamp with DMC #742 before attaching the black trim to each.
Use foam squares to attach all the elements (except the flat rug).
I love this card’s retro vibe, so I decided to place a sentiment on the inside. I didn’t like its placement anywhere on the front.
